CanalDigitaal selects Simac Broadcast to expand HD and SD head-end

Veldhoven, September 7, 2007

For the expansions of its digital head-ends, CanalDigitaal in the Netherlands selected Simac Broadcast to supply, integrate and service compression solutions from Harmonic Inc. The total project covers the implementation of three fully redundant Harmonic compression systems and distributed statistical multiplexing for the new MPEG4 Standard Definition (SD), MPEG4 High Definition (HD) and MPEG2 SD services. The project will cover multiple locations from CanalDigitaal in the Netherlands, Luxembourg and Belgium.
 
 
System Architecture
 
In close cooperation with Harmonic Inc., Simac Broadcast implemented a full demonstration system for CanalDigitaal to test and verify the functionality requested. During the evaluation process, continuous collaboration by all parties delivered a verified design for a future proof head-end based on MPEG-over-IP.
 
The CanalDigitaal headend includes Harmonic’s DiviCom® Electra™ 7000 HD MPEG-4 AVC (H.264) encoders and Electra 5000 series SD encoders. In addition to the outstanding bandwidth efficiency and picture quality available with the Harmonic compression solutions, CanalDigitaal is utilizing Harmonic’s DiviTrackIP™ distributed statistical multiplexing to further improve service carrying capacity and manage the satellite transport channel lineups in a more flexible manner.

About CanalDigitaal and TV-Vlaanderen
CanalDigitaal and TV-Vlaanderen are combined the largest provider of digital TV in the Benelux with more than 800,000 customers. CanalDigitaal and TV-Vlaanderen operate via direct broadcast satellite, providing customers access to all the Dutch and Flemish public and commercial broadcasters, premium sports and movie services, thematic channels and a wide range of free-to-air channels in various languages currently available on Astra (more than 200).
